What can be said about I Care A Lot? It's based on a true story. Nope, not that. But like that, this film is filled with misdirection, twists and turns galore. But will you care a lot about it?

PROS - Rosamund Pike plays Marla Grayson who is a con artist of sorts. This performance is the single best thing this movie has going for it, but certainly not the only thing. Pike is fantastic in the role and has already received much praise from critics groups. The odd thing about this performance, one of the finest of the year, is that we, the audience, are actively rooting against this anti-hero, almost from the very start. She's ruthless, brilliant and cunning and without getting into spoilers, we almost revel is seeing her wicked deeds but then also getting her comeuppance.

It's a fair delight as we watch Marla go about her business, learn about her work and get to watch the trouble she brings upon herself and her friends. The screenwriting and dialogue is excellent, as well as the pacing, the film progresses nicely and I can't imagine anyone getting bored by this film. It's easy to watch Marla as the story keeps on rolling, twists and turns keep the audience right there to the end, we need to find out where it all goes. The music and score is well constructed, the tempo picks up and amp up the anxiety and pressure of the situations Marla finds herself in. With all that is this bound to be among the years best films?

CONS - There aren't many things to take issue with in this film on the technical side, but the story itself is fairly shallow. It's entertainment value is through the roof but leaves you with nothing in the end. No takeaway, no lessons, nothing under the surface. Maybe don't be bad. And while that's fine for some, a quick bit of fun, others will be looking for more in a film.

SUMMARY - All in all most people will have a blast and enjoy the trip this movie takes you on. But that's all it is, just like a rollercoaster, you'll get on, enjoy the ride, get off and go about your business. I doubt this film will go down in history as a great film, so take it for what it is. You'll care a lot about this movie while you watch it and forget it the moment it's over.
